New Hillsdale ordinances may shut homeless shelter

By Editorial Board Published October 8, 2025 3 Min Read
Share
New Hillsdale ordinances may shut homeless shelter

JACKSON, Mich. (WLNS) — A Hillsdale shelter that has helped lots of get again on their ft may quickly be compelled to shut on account of a brand new metropolis ordinance. Hillsdale native Melissa Desjardin based Camp Hope with a aim to be the primary 24-hour homeless facility within the metropolis.

“Why wouldn’t you want to provide for the least of these? Why not?” Desjardin stated. 

(WLNS)

She says the camp has helped over 300 folks since 2023 discover secure housing and rebuild their lives however now that mission is in danger.

“We’ve already been doing it for two and a half years and so why not make it a permanent structure? We’re almost there,” Desjardin stated. 

In July 2023, the Department Hillsdale St. Joseph Neighborhood Well being Company issued a violation of state campground regulation, prompting Desjardin to downsize the house to at least one giant tent for residents.

10 7 graney web story photo 3(WLNS)

Throughout a Monday metropolis council assembly, council members ironed out a complete plan for the elimination of the house because of the lack of permits in compliance with metropolis ordinances.

“Where were they going to go? There’s nothing here in Hillsdale. We have shared the warmth, but it’s only open during the winter months and during the day it’s not open for them,” Desjardin stated. 

Charlie Stability got here to Camp Hope in July after he says he escaped a violent grownup foster dwelling state of affairs in Osseo. He says the camp has offered him with freedom, belonging, and hope.

“Because I didn’t have that. Not even when I was a child,” Stability stated.

10 7 graney web story photo 4(WLNS)

In an announcement offered to six Information, town supervisor’s workplace stated:

This motion follows the property proprietor’s failure to appropriate the violation and take away the tent construction throughout the 14-day interval offered for within the consent settlement. It additionally comes after repeated efforts by the Metropolis over the previous a number of years to work collaboratively with the property proprietor towards voluntary compliance.

Desjardin says the shelter plans to rebrand below the brand new identify Hope Harbor and transition resident housing to a bigger construction with extra facilities.
